An adaptive fault diagnosis framework under class-imbalanced conditions based on contrastive augmented deep reinforcement learning

被引:20
作者
Zhao, Qin [1 ,2 ,3 ]
Ding, Yu [1 ,2 ,3 ]
Lu, Chen [1 ,2 ,3 ]
Wang, Chao [1 ,2 ,3 ]
Ma, Liang [1 ,2 ,3 ]
Tao, Laifa [1 ,2 ,3 ]
Ma, Jian [1 ,2 ,3 ]
机构
[1] Beihang Univ, Inst Reliabil Engn, Beijing 100191, Peoples R China
[2] Sci & Technol Reliabil & Environm Engn Lab, Beijing 100191, Peoples R China
[3] Beihang Univ, Sch Reliabil & Syst Engn, Beijing 100191, Peoples R China
基金
中国国家自然科学基金;
关键词
Class-imbalanced condition; Fault diagnosis; Deep reinforcement learning; Contrastive learning; Rotating machinery; NETWORKS;
D O I
10.1016/j.eswa.2023.121001
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
In practical scenarios, it is difficult to acquire fault data from rotating machinery, resulting in class-imbalanced problems in the fault diagnosis field. Training a fault diagnosis model directly on an imbalanced dataset may lead to overfitting for minority classes and skewness toward majority classes. Thus, we propose a fault diagnosis framework based on contrastive augmented deep reinforcement learning (CADRL) with two-stage training. In the pretraining stage, we obtain sample pairs based on the batch construction strategy to calculate the contrastive loss. Then, this loss is used to train a feature extraction model to reduce intraclass distances and increase interclass distances. During the fine-tuning stage, an adaptive reward function that updates with the sample label distribution is adopted in the fault diagnosis model. This function can balance the attention given by the model to different fault modes and improve fault diagnosis performance on imbalanced data without prior knowledge. Case studies conducted on two public datasets demonstrate that the pretraining stage can provide a well-trained feature extraction model, which can be merged into the proposed fault diagnosis model to achieve better fault diagnosis performance than that of other advanced models.
引用
收藏
页数:14
相关论文
共 48 条
[1]   Managing engineering systems with large state and action spaces through deep reinforcement learning [J].
Andriotis, C. P. ;
Papakonstantinou, K. G. .
RELIABILITY ENGINEERING & SYSTEM SAFETY, 2019, 191
[2]  
Chen T, 2020, PR MACH LEARN RES, V119
[3]   Learning a similarity metric discriminatively, with application to face verification [J].
Chopra, S ;
Hadsell, R ;
LeCun, Y .
2005 IEEE COMPUTER SOCIETY C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ION, VOL 1, PROCEEDINGS, 2005, :539-546
[4]   Class-Balanced Loss Based on Effective Number of Samples [J].
Cui, Yin ;
Jia, Menglin ;
Lin, Tsung-Yi ;
Song, Yang ;
Belongie, Serge .
2019 IEEE/CVF C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ION (CVPR 2019), 2019, :9260-9269
[5]   Application of deep reinforcement learning for extremely rare failure prediction in aircraft maintenance [J].
Dangut, Maren David ;
Jennions, Ian K. ;
King, Steve ;
Skaf, Zakwan .
MECHANICAL SYSTEMS AND SIGNAL PROCESSING, 2022, 171
[6]   Intelligent fault diagnosis for rotating machinery using deep Q-network based health state classification: A deep reinforcement learning approach [J].
Ding, Yu ;
Ma, Liang ;
Ma, Jian ;
Suo, Mingliang ;
Tao, Laifa ;
Cheng, Yujie ;
Lu, Chen .
ADVANCED ENGINEERING INFORMATICS, 2019, 42
[7]   Joint imbalanced classification and feature selection for hospital readmissions [J].
Du, Guodong ;
Zhang, Jia ;
Luo, Zhiming ;
Ma, Fenglong ;
Ma, Lei ;
Li, Shaozi .
KNOWLEDGE-BASED SYSTEMS, 2020, 200
[8]   Imbalanced Sample Selection With Deep Reinforcement Learning for Fault Diagnosis [J].
Fan, Saite ;
Zhang, Xinmin ;
Song, Zhihuan .
IEEE TRANSACTIONS ON INDUSTRIAL INFORMATICS, 2022, 18 (04) :2518-2527
[9]   A Hierarchical Training-Convolutional Neural Network for Imbalanced Fault Diagnosis in Complex Equipment [J].
Gao, Yiping ;
Gao, Liang ;
Li, Xinyu ;
Cao, Siyu .
IEEE TRANSACTIONS ON INDUSTRIAL INFORMATICS, 2022, 18 (11) :8138-8145
[10]   Bogie fault diagnosis under variable operating conditions based on fast kurtogram and deep residual learning towards imbalanced data [J].
Geng, Yixuan ;
Wang, Zhipeng ;
Jia, Limin ;
Qin, Yong ;
Chen, Xinan .
MEASUREMENT, 2020, 166